The Gibson Custom Shop 1964 ES-335 Reissue VOS in Sixties Cherry captures one of the most pivotal eras in Gibson’s history, bringing to life the elegance, tone, and feel of an original mid-’60s semi-hollow masterpiece. With its instantly recognizable double-cutaway ES-335 body shape, this reissue is crafted from a carefully layered 3-ply maple/poplar/maple body construction, paired with a solid maple center block to balance resonance and sustain while controlling feedback. Outlined with 1-ply Royalite binding and finished in a gently aged nitrocellulose lacquer VOS patina, the guitar exudes the look and character of a well-preserved vintage instrument without sacrificing authenticity.

The neck is made from solid mahogany and carved into an authentic ’64 medium C-shape profile, a favorite among players for its comfortable, rounded feel that falls perfectly between slim and substantial. It is set into the body with a long tenon joint using traditional hide glue construction, ensuring maximum resonance transfer. Topped with a 24.75" Indian rosewood fingerboard also hide-glue fit, it features a 12" radius, 22 authentic medium-jumbo frets, and period-correct small block cellulose nitrate inlays, delivering both historic accuracy and smooth playability. The nylon nut measures 1.69" (42.85mm), keeping the string spacing faithful to vintage specs while enhancing tuning stability.

Every detail of the hardware has been recreated with stunning precision. The ABR-1 bridge is paired with a lightweight aluminum stop bar tailpiece and nylon saddles, giving the guitar its signature singing sustain and slightly softened top end. Nickel plating throughout—including the Kluson single line, double ring tuners—adds a touch of understated class, while historically accurate touches like the black 5-ply wide bevel pickguard, authentic stepped 2-ply truss rod cover, and gold or black Top Hat knobs with silver inserts make this reissue virtually indistinguishable from an original. Even the aluminum strap buttons, black M69 mounting rings, and nickel-silver pickup covers were designed to echo vintage parts.

At the heart of its sound are a pair of unpotted Custombucker Alnico III pickups, meticulously voiced to recreate the warmth, clarity, and bloom of original mid-’60s PAFs. Wired with CTS 500K audio taper potentiometers and paper-in-oil capacitors, the controls offer organic responsiveness, while a 3-way Switchcraft toggle and Switchcraft output jack ensure reliability both on stage and in the studio. From shimmering cleans to articulate overdrive, the tonal palette is as versatile as it is unmistakably Gibson.

Each Gibson Custom Shop 1964 ES-335 Reissue VOS comes strung with .010–.046 gauge strings, and is housed in a black/yellow Custom Shop hardshell case, accompanied by a Certificate of Authenticity.
